reboot
英 [ˌriːˈbuːt]
美 [ˌriːˈbuːt]
v. 重新启动
过去式:rebooted 过去分词:rebooted 现在分词:rebooting 复数:reboots 第三人称单数:reboots
BNC.47272 / COCA.27449
牛津词典
verb
- 重新启动
if you reboot a computer or it reboots , you switch it off and then start it again immediately
英英释义
verb
- cause to load (an operating system) and start the initial processes
- boot your computer
